This Biker Minion is a high energy collectible figurine that reimagines the beloved yellow character as a tough leather clad motorcycle rider. The figure sports a studded jacket riding goggles biker boots fingerless gloves and a confident stance that captures the personality of the open road. Sculpted details include jacket creases zipper lines belt buckles boot stitching and small accessory patches that add depth and character. The geometry is prepared for clean printing on both FDM and resin machines with carefully balanced wall thickness so makers of every level can produce reliable copies. Collectors hobbyists motorcycle enthusiasts and gift makers can display the figure on shelves bookcases office desks or themed dioramas featuring small bikes and rural roads. It works equally well as a centerpiece for birthday gifts hobby club events or themed bedroom decor. Recommended scale begins at six centimeters for a desktop figure and can scale up to fifteen centimeters for a feature display piece. A layer height of 0.12 millimeters preserves the jacket and accessory detail while keeping print time efficient. Tree supports are needed beneath the arms and under the jacket flaps. Infill of 15 percent gives the figure plenty of stability. Sanding priming and acrylic paint allow makers to bring the figure to life with rich blacks bright yellows metallic studs and weathered leather tones. Files are provided in OBJ STL and PLY formats for compatibility with mainstream slicers and modeling tools.
